Output efbb1f53579eb0d6cb4ac01e83d14cf1915ab2171f42013e38fd74caef0a558b:1

value
1338414
script pubkey
OP_0 OP_PUSHBYTES_20 17089e7941a288cae8e85214c17d8b0692937380
address
bc1qzuyfu72p52yv468g2g2vzlvtq6ffxuuqrt6e89
transaction
efbb1f53579eb0d6cb4ac01e83d14cf1915ab2171f42013e38fd74caef0a558b
confirmations
67813
spent
true